- Zircon is a maneuvering, winged hypersonic cruise missile with a lift-generating heart physique. A booster stage with solid-fuel engines accelerates it to supersonic speeds, after which a scramjet motor with liquid-fuel within the second stage accelerates it to hypersonic speeds.
- The missile’s vary is estimated to be 135 to 270 nautical miles (155 to 311 mi; 250 to 500 km) at low degree, and as much as 400 nmi (460 mi; 740 km) in a semi-ballistic trajectory. The longest attainable vary is 540 nmi (620 mi; 1,000 km) and for this goal a brand new gasoline was created.
- Zircon can journey at a velocity of Mach 8–Mach 9 (6,090–6,851 mph; 9,800–11,025 km/h; 2.7223–3.0626 km/s). This has led to considerations that it might penetrate present naval protection methods. Because the missile flies at hypersonic speeds inside the environment, the air stress in entrance of it kinds a plasma cloud because it strikes, absorbing radio waves and making it virtually invisible to energetic radar methods. Zircon exchanges data in flight and will be managed by instructions if vital.
